Output edb2a3ed28023298ff87ba195fc533ec7980f3ba36d6a4ab3a7dec49d986fb03:1

value
665667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7832f0edf03b4fa154fe678b6aee374c3d02bb8f OP_EQUAL
address
3Cea31qRpeh8Fwh3rLgZaUpigLJeU3mDw2
transaction
edb2a3ed28023298ff87ba195fc533ec7980f3ba36d6a4ab3a7dec49d986fb03
confirmations
38118
spent
true